I guess he did choose to pincer, as I mentioned in my previous post. I still believe, as I did then, that I would be at an advantage in such a fight.

My move is a basic attack and defense tactic. Attack one side, and then you will have power to attack the other. He cannot have both.

Black can either give me his stone here, or I will get enough power to do some damage to his left group. I don't think I would have played this way as white.

I have confidence in this fight.
